<PackageReference Include="Polly.Core" Version="8.0.0-beta.1" />

TimeProvider

abstract class TimeProvider
public static TimeProvider System { get; }

public virtual TimeZoneInfo LocalTimeZone { get; }

public virtual long TimestampFrequency { get; }

protected TimeProvider()

public virtual ITimer CreateTimer(TimerCallback callback, object state, TimeSpan dueTime, TimeSpan period)

public TimeSpan GetElapsedTime(long startingTimestamp, long endingTimestamp)

public TimeSpan GetElapsedTime(long startingTimestamp)

public virtual long GetTimestamp()

public virtual DateTimeOffset GetUtcNow()